‘Empyre’ wins the 2021 GLAAD award for ‘Outstanding Comic Book’

Marvel’s summer event series, which ended with Wiccan and Hulkling tying the knot, has been recognized by GLAAD.

The GLAAD Awards have recognized several comics from Marvel’s Empyre event for “Outstanding Comic Book” during their 2021 awards.

The recognition was announced on Twitter, where writers Al Ewing, Dan Slott and Anthony Oliveira were all featured in the acceptance video:
